Crispy Zucchini Fritters

These irresistible Crispy Zucchini Fritters are perfect as an appetizer or side dish, featuring a golden crunchy exterior and a soft, herb-infused center.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Appetizer, Side Dish
Cuisine: American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

Fritter Mixture
  • 2 medium zucchinis, grated Grated and moisture squeezed out
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up all-purpose flour Can be substituted with gluten-free blend
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h herbs (like parsley or basil)
  • 1 large egg Can be substituted with flaxseed meal for vegan
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• Oil for frying For frying the fritters
  • Dipping sauce (optional) Recommended: tzatziki, ranch, or aioli

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Grate the zucchinis and place them in a clean kitchen towel. Squeeze out excess moisture.
  2. In a large bowl, combine the grated zucchini with salt and let it sit for about 10 minutes.
  3. Add flour, grated Parmesan cheese, fresh herbs, egg, garlic powder, and black pepper to zucchini. Mix until well combined.
Cooking
  1.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at.
  2. Drop spoonfuls of the mixture into the hot oil and flatten them slightly.
  3. Fry for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and crispy.
  4. Remove from skillet and place on a paper towel to drain excess oil.
Serving
  1. Serve warm with your favorite dipping sauce.

Notes

Patience is key: Allow the grated zucchini to drain well; excess moisture leads to soggy fritters. You can experiment with different dips for variety. For added heat, try adding cayenne pepper.
